2-4. What are Arpeggios and why you should play them
(Updated: )-
play the chord tones
-
word mean: Broken chord. the Italian meaning is Harp-like, due to the nature of the instrument, the notes on a Harp sustain. / Fundamentally, every note is played individually.
-
difference between chord and arpeggios
-
chord: played at the same time.
-
arpeggios: play chord tones individually in sequence either up or down.
-
-
C Triad/ C Major arpeggios
-
C Major Triad: C -> E -> G
-
C Major Arpeggios: C -> E -> G -> C
